South Salt Lake police search for driver they say caused 2 crashes and fled

SOUTH SALT LAKE, Utah, July 1, 2019 (Gephardt Daily) — Police are looking for a male driver who allegedly caused a crash, fled the scene, and caused another crash Monday evening.

South Salt Lake Police Sgt. Matt Oehler said officers were able to take two women passengers into custody shortly before 8 p.m., when they and the driver ran from the “older Mitsubishi passenger car” at 2700 S. State St.

The driver, however, managed to evade the officers.

“We have a potential I.D. for the driver,” Oehler told Gephardt Daily, “and we expect to have him in custody soon.”

It wasn’t yet known why the driver fled the scene of the first crash.

Oehler said the first car that was struck by the suspect vehicle rolled onto its top and had “substantial damage.” The second car that was hit “had its front end totaled.”

Two people were in one car and three in the other, Oehler said. They all had minor injuries, but only two were transported to the hospital.
